The XC3S400-4TQG144I belongs to the category of Field Programmable Gate Arrays (FPGAs).
FPGAs are integrated circuits that can be programmed after manufacturing. They are widely used in various electronic applications, including telecommunications, automotive, aerospace, and consumer electronics.
The XC3S400-4TQG144I comes in a Quad Flat No-Lead (QFN) package.
The essence of this FPGA lies in its ability to implement complex digital logic functions, enabling designers to create custom hardware solutions without the need for traditional fixed-function integrated circuits.
The XC3S400-4TQG144I is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The XC3S400-4TQG144I has a total of 144 pins. The pin configuration is as follows:
(Pin Number) (Pin Name) 1. VCCINT 2. GND 3. IOL1PT0AD0P35 4. IOL1NT1AD0N35 5. IOL2PT0AD1P35 6. IOL2NT1AD1N35 7. IOL3PT0AD2P35 8. IOL3NT1AD2N35 9. IOL4PT0AD3P35 10. IOL4NT1AD3N35 11. IOL5PT0AD4P35 12. IOL5NT1AD4N35 13. IOL6PT0AD5P35 14. IOL6NT1AD5N35 15. IOL7PT0AD6P35 16. IOL7NT1AD6N35 17. IOL8PT0AD7P35 18. IOL8NT1AD7N35 19. GND 20. VCCINT
(Note: The pin configuration continues for all 144 pins)
The XC3S400-4TQG144I offers the following functional features:
FPGAs consist of an array of configurable logic blocks interconnected by programmable routing resources. The configuration data stored in the FPGA determines the behavior of the circuit. During operation, input signals are processed through the configurable logic blocks, allowing for the implementation of complex digital functions.
The XC3S400-4TQG144I finds applications in various fields, including:
Sure! Here are 10 common questions and answers related to the application of XC3S400-4TQG144I in technical solutions:
Question: What is XC3S400-4TQG144I?
Answer: XC3S400-4TQG144I is a field-programmable gate array (FPGA) from Xilinx, which offers programmable logic and digital signal processing capabilities.
Question: What are the key features of XC3S400-4TQG144I?
Answer: Some key features include 400K system gates, 432 user I/Os, 36Kbits of block RAM, and support for various communication protocols.
Question: What are the typical applications of XC3S400-4TQG144I?
Answer: XC3S400-4TQG144I is commonly used in applications such as industrial automation, telecommunications, automotive electronics, and high-performance computing.
Question: How can I program XC3S400-4TQG144I?
Answer: XC3S400-4TQG144I can be programmed using Xilinx's Vivado Design Suite or ISE Design Suite software tools.
Question: Can XC3S400-4TQG144I interface with other components or devices?
Answer: Yes, XC3S400-4TQG144I supports various communication protocols like SPI, I2C, UART, and Ethernet, allowing it to interface with other components or devices.
Question: What is the power supply requirement for XC3S400-4TQG144I?
Answer: XC3S400-4TQG144I typically operates at a voltage range of 1.14V to 1.26V, with a maximum power consumption of around 1.5W.
Question: Can XC3S400-4TQG144I be used in high-reliability applications?
Answer: Yes, XC3S400-4TQG144I is designed to meet the requirements of various industrial and automotive standards, making it suitable for high-reliability applications.
Question: Are there any development boards available for XC3S400-4TQG144I?
Answer: Yes, Xilinx offers development boards like the Spartan-3A Evaluation Kit, which can be used for prototyping and testing with XC3S400-4TQG144I.
Question: Can XC3S400-4TQG144I be used for real-time signal processing?
Answer: Yes, XC3S400-4TQG144I's digital signal processing capabilities make it suitable for real-time signal processing applications.
Question: Is technical support available for XC3S400-4TQG144I?
Answer: Yes, Xilinx provides technical support through their website, forums, and documentation to assist users with XC3S400-4TQG144I-related queries or issues.
Please note that the answers provided here are general and may vary depending on specific use cases and requirements.